Three Ingredient Pineapple Teriyaki Meatballs

Ingredients:
- 1 lb frozen homestyle meatballs
- 1 cup Sweet Baby Ray’s Sweet Teriyaki Sauce
- 1 cup crushed pineapple
Optional: Fresh pineapple, for garnish and toothpicks to insert garnish.
Instructions:
Add frozen meatball to a large sauce pot, then add your teriyaki sauce.
(Optionally, add to a crockpot)
Next, add the crushed pineapple to the pot.
Stir meatballs till evenly coated. Cook on high, bringing to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over and simmer for 8-10 minutes (for thawed meatballs) or 15-17 mins (for frozen) stirring occasionally.
For a crockpot, cook on low for 4-6 hours or high 2-3 hours. (Better for larger portions)
Serve warm. Garnish with fresh pineapple, if desired.
This easy appetizer would be great for a Luau or cookout party.
